授業概要

The aim of this course is to help students develop fluency in reading skills by improving comprehension, grammar and vocabulary. This course will also help you to develop personal and cross-cultural awareness and understanding by learning about and discussing various themes that will help you find out more about other cultures, your own culture and values, and about yourself.
 
Topics: Topics include: male-female relationships, love, marriage, family relationships, personal values, parents and children, happiness and what is important in life?

到達目標

We will read several powerful short stories written by a variety of international authors. Students will participate in various creative discussion and writing activities that stimulate the imagination and help them to understand the themes of the story and apply what they learn to their daily lives.

授業方法

The teaching method is based on active, cooperative learning. Students will be expected to actively participate in a variety of reading, writing, listening, and speaking activities including individualized work, pair work, group work, and short presentations.

準備学習

Read the relevant passage before class and complete assignments. (approx. 30 - 60 minutes).

成績評価の方法

Attendance and Class Participation:34%
Homework and Assignments:33%
Final Exam:33%
Each of the following will count for part of your final course grade: (1) taking an active part in discussion and class activities, (2) completion of weekly class assignments and one report (3) Final test: This is a “take-home” test (written out of class) which includes several short comprehension questions and a short reflective essay/report based on the short stories.
